Why is the landform of Nepal useful?​

Geography
1 answer:
Alexxandr [17]2 years ago
8 0

Answer: The Himalayan region can be promoted for tourism. Crops like wheat, millet, and corn can be grown in the hill region which is mostly covered with dense forests and rice, and sugar cane can be grown in the Terai region. This way Nepal can utilize its diversity of areas and be economically stable country.

The Australia – United States Free Trade Agreement (AUSFTA) is a preferential trade agreement between Australia and the United States modelled on the North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A). TheAUSFTA was signed on 18 May 2004 and came into effect on 1 January 2005. On the other hand, tThe United States–Israel Free Trade Agreement is a trade pact between the State of Israel and the United States of America established in 1985 that lowered barriers to trade in some goods. And lastly, the North American Free Trade Agreement is an agreement signed by Canada, Mexico, and the United States, creating a trilateral trade bloc in North America.<span>
